What Are Local Business Directories?
Local business directories are online platforms where businesses can list their details, including name, address, phone number (NAP), website, and services. These directories act as online databases, making it easier for customers to find local businesses relevant to their needs. Examples include Google Business Profile, Yelp, and Yellow Pages.
Importance of Free Local Business Directories
1. Enhanced Online Presence
- Business directories help businesses appear in local search results, increasing visibility.
2. Improved Local SEO
- Listings in high-authority directories boost search engine rankings, helping businesses rank higher in Google searches.
3. Increased Customer Trust
- A business with verified listings in multiple directories appears more credible and reliable to potential customers.
4. Cost-Effective Marketing
- Most directories offer free listings, allowing businesses to promote themselves without additional expenses.
5. Higher Engagement & Conversions
- Customers looking for specific services in their area can directly contact businesses listed in these directories.

1. Google Business Profile (GBP)
🔗 https://www.google.com/business/
- Purpose: Manage how your business appears on Google Search and Google Maps.
- Key Features:
- Free listings with photos, posts, and updates.
- Customer reviews and Q&A.
- Insights on search queries and customer actions.
2. Yelp
- Purpose: Customer reviews and ratings for local businesses.
- Key Features:
- Free and paid advertising options.
- Strong influence on consumer decisions (especially restaurants/services).
3. Facebook Business
🔗 https://www.facebook.com/business
- Purpose: Social media marketing and local engagement.
- Key Features:
- Business pages with reviews, events, and ads.
- Messenger for customer communication.
4. Bing Places for Business
- Purpose: Microsoft’s equivalent to GBP (appears on Bing Search).
- Key Features:
- Free listing with photos and business info.
- Integration with Windows and Cortana.
5. Apple Maps
🔗 https://mapsconnect.apple.com
- Purpose: Business visibility for Apple users and Siri searches.
- Key Features:
- Free listing with photos and directions.
- Used by iPhone/iPad/Mac users.
6. Yahoo Local
🔗 https://local.yahoo.com (Part of Verizon Media)
- Purpose: Local search engine visibility.
- Key Features:
- Syndicates data from other directories.
7. Better Business Bureau (BBB)
- Purpose: Trust and credibility platform.
- Key Features:
- Accreditation boosts reputation.
- Complaint resolution system.
8. Foursquare
🔗 https://foursquare.com/business
- Purpose: Location-based marketing & check-ins.
- Key Features:
- Popular for restaurants and retail.

How to Make a Perfect Business Listing?
A well-optimized business listing ensures better engagement and visibility. Here’s a step-by-step guide to creating a perfect listing for any type of business:
1. Choose the Right Directories
- Select directories that cater to your industry and location.
- Prioritize high-authority directories like Google Business Profile and Yelp.
2. Ensure NAP Consistency
- Your Name, Address, and Phone Number (NAP) should be identical across all listings.
- Inconsistent information can harm SEO and reduce credibility.
3. Add a Detailed Business Description
- Provide a clear and engaging description of your business, including services, specialties, and unique selling points.
- Use relevant keywords naturally to improve search rankings.
4. Select the Right Business Category
- Choose the most relevant category that describes your business.
- Some directories allow multiple categories—select all applicable ones.
5. Include High-Quality Images & Videos
- Upload clear, professional images of your storefront, products, team, and services.
- Videos showcasing your work or customer testimonials enhance credibility.
6. Add Website & Social Media Links
- Provide your website URL to drive traffic.
- Include links to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, or other relevant social media profiles.
7. Encourage Customer Reviews
- Reviews build trust and improve rankings in search results.
- Ask satisfied customers to leave reviews and respond to them promptly.
8. Update Information Regularly
- Keep your business hours, address, and contact details up to date.
- Post updates about offers, events, or new services.
9. Monitor & Analyze Performance
- Use analytics tools provided by directories to track views, clicks, and customer interactions.
- Adjust your listing strategy based on insights gained.
10. Engage with Your Audience
- Respond to customer inquiries and reviews professionally.
- Offer promotions or discounts through directory platforms to attract new customers.
